What is Badal Hajj?
Badal Hajj refers to performing the pilgrimage on behalf of someone else who is unable to do it themselves due to death, illness, or old age. The person performing Hajj (usually a qualified scholar or experienced pilgrim) carries out all rituals with the intention for the beneficiary.
This practice is supported by authentic Hadith, where the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) permitted Hajj to be performed on behalf of others under valid circumstances.
Who Needs Badal Hajj?
Badal Hajj may be arranged for:
- A deceased parent, relative, or loved one
- Someone permanently ill or disabled
- Elderly individuals unable to travel
- Individuals who had the financial means but did not perform Hajj
Fulfilling this duty ensures that the obligation of Hajj is completed on their behalf.

Important Islamic Conditions
- The person performing Hajj must have completed their own Hajj first
- The intention (niyyah) must clearly be for the beneficiary
- Only one Badal Hajj can be performed per person per year
- The beneficiary must have been eligible for Hajj during their lifetime
